Hi,

I hope some one can help me with this matter. I have the next configuration on a router asynchronous line:

interface Group-Async1

physical-layer async

ip unnumbered FastEthernet0/0

no ip redirects

no ip unreachables

encapsulation ppp

async mode interactive

peer default ip address pool dhpool

ppp authentication ms-chap

group-range 0/1/0 0/1/7

line 0/1/4 0/1/6

session-timeout 15 output

exec-timeout 10 59

modem InOut

modem autoconfigure discovery

transport input all

autoselect during-login

autoselect ppp

speed 115200

line 0/1/7

modem InOut

modem autoconfigure discovery

transport input all

autoselect during-login

autoselect ppp

speed 38400

from 0/1/0 to 0/1/3 are free. On 0/1/7 I got a ISND modem, and the rest of them (0/1/4 to 0/1/6) are analog modem conneted.

The output of ppp and modem debug is:

Hi

I think there is some problem with the config.In u r config using the group-async1 u have combined all the lines and configured all the parameters which will effect all the lines.

And in the second section u r trying to configure the lines individually which are already a part of group-async1.Try to isolate and check.
